The Reading Series That Was
On Tuesday, April 5, we held the last event in our 2011 Commonwealth Reading Series, and Regie O'Hare Gibson, David Lovelace, Tova Mirvis, Leslie Williams, and Lara JK Wilson proffered poetry and prose to the delight and invigoration of the assembled Newtonville Books audience.
